Boone Gorges de7c9b6015 Move new user notification emails to add_action() callbacks.
When a new user is created in various places throughout the interface,
notifications are sent to the site admin and the new user. Previously, these
notifications were fired through direct calls to `wp_new_user_notification()`,
making it difficult to stop or modify the messages.

This changeset introduces a number of new action hooks in place of direct calls
to `wp_new_user_notification()`, and hooks the new wrapper function
`wp_send_new_user_notifications()` to these hooks.

Boone Gorges 0adb6877b2 Improve validation of user_login and user_nicename length.
The `user_login` field only allows 60 characters, and `user_nicename` allows
50. However, there are no protections in the interface, and few in the code,
that prevent the creation of users with values in excess of these limits. Prior
to recent changes in `$wpdb`, users were generally created anyway, MySQL
having performed the necessary truncation. More recently, the `INSERT`s and
`UPDATE`s simply fail, with no real feedback on the nature of the failure.

This changeset addresses the issue in a number of ways:
* On the user-new.php and network/user-new.php panels, don't allow input in excess of the maximum field length.
* In `wp_insert_user()`, throw an error if the value provided for `'user_login'` or `'user_nicename'` exceeds the maximum field length.
* In `wp_insert_user()`, when using `'user_login'` to generate a default value for `'user_nicename'`, ensure that the nicename is properly truncated, even when suffixed for uniqueness (username-2, etc).

Dominik Schilling (ocean90) 08098026ce Passwords: Deprecate second parameter of wp_new_user_notification().
The second parameter `$plaintext_pass` was removed in [33023] and restored as `$notify` in [33620] with a different behavior. If you have a plugin overriding `wp_new_user_notification()` which hasn't been updated you would get a notification with your username and the password "both".
To prevent this the second parameter is now deprecated and reintroduced as the third parameter.

Boone Gorges 6064924c18 Send password-change email notifications via hook.
`wp_password_change_notification()` is now called at the 'after_password_reset'
action, rather than being invoked directly from the `reset_password()` function.

In order to make it possible to call `wp_password_change_notification()` as a
`do_action()` callback, the function signature has to be changed so that the
`$user` parameter is expected to be a value rather than a reference. Since
PHP 5.0, objects are passed by reference, so `&$user` was unnecessary anyway.
